Oregon Trail Seeds
North Powder & Imbler, Oregon
Seed products & services

Locations

Our primary warehouse operations are located in Imbler, with additional warehouse capacity in North Powder.

Main Warehouse

65268 Striker Ln.
Imbler, OR 97841

View Larger Map Striker Lane warehouse New construction at Striker Lane Striker Lane facility view

North Powder Warehouse

100 D St.
North Powder, OR 97867

View Larger Map

3rd Street Warehouse

110 3rd St
Imbler, OR 97841

View Larger Map